Asia Cup: Bangladesh elect to field against India, Jaker Ali leads in place of injured Litton Das

Dubai, September 24, 2025: Bangladesh won the toss and opted to field first against India in a high-stakes ACC Men’s T20 Asia Cup 2025 Super Four clash at the Dubai International Cricket Stadium on Wednesday.

The Tigers were dealt a blow ahead of the contest as their regular skipper Litton Das was ruled out due to a side strain. Jaker Ali has taken over captaincy duties for this crucial fixture.

India enjoy a commanding head-to-head record in the format, with 16 wins in 17 T20Is against Bangladesh, who have managed just a single victory.

Both teams enter the encounter with strong form. India are on a six-match winning streak, while Bangladesh have recorded four victories in their last five outings, setting up a competitive battle in Dubai.
